![]() TITLE: GCN CIRCULAR NUMBER: 9407 SUBJECT: GRB 090519: Swift/UVOT Upper Limits DATE: 09/05/20 03:27:00 GMT FROM: Stefan Immler at NASA/GSFC <stefan.m.immler@nasa.gov> S. Immler (NASA/CRESST/GSFC), and M. Perri (ASDC) report on behalf of the Swift/UVOT team: The Swift/UVOT observed the field of GRB 090519 starting 106 s after
the BAT trigger (Perri et al., GCN 9400). No optical afterglow
is detected in the initial UVOT exposures at the enhanced position
of the X-ray afterglow (Goad et al., GCN 9405) or the position
of the NOT afterglow candidate (Thoene et al. GCN 9403).
Three-sigma upper limits using the UVOT photometric system
(Poole et al. 2008, MNRAS, 383, 627) are:
Filter T_start(s) T_stop(s) Exp(s) Mag
white 123 7430 862 >21.5
v 106 7841 597 >19.8
b 536 7224 568 >20.6
u 281 7019 617 >20.4
uvw1 662 8131 469 >20.3
uvm2 637 8046 587 >20.4
uvw2 588 7636 549 >20.6
The values quoted above are not corrected for the Galactic extinction due
to the reddening of E(B-V) = 0.04 in the direction of the burst
(Schlegel et al. 1998).
